TEXT: This is in response to your letter of March 7, 1980, asking whether ASTM E501 and E524 tires must be graded in accordance with the Uniform Tire Quality Grading (UTQG) Standards (49 CFR 575.104). You state that these tires are manufactured in limited quantities as standards for traction testing and are not manufactured for general highway use. It is the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ration's understanding that these tires are used only on a test trailer designed for use in skid testing.

The UTQG regulation applies to new pneumatic tires for use on passenger cars (49 CFR 575.104(c)(1)). Thus, ASTM E501 and E524, which are manufactured solely for use on a traction test trailer, would not fall within the application of the UTQG Standards.

We are requesting an interpretation of Part 575.104 - Uniform Tire Quality Grading Standards - with reference to the ASTM E501 and E524 tires.

Since these tires are manufactured in limited quantities as standards for skid resistance testing and are not manufactured for general highway use, it is our understanding that they are not covered by the requirements of Part 575.104.

Would you please confirm this interpretation.
